Output 76289191588b28a14ec644dd21d65a754488ec01a0f990c89827aafa6b92c213:1

value
23319426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e88ac46d75dd6d03b1ea051fac9732aba93c6d0 OP_EQUAL
address
34UTvW5QPCSFQ8Sh1Lujs4dMnuxErWkrxr
transaction
76289191588b28a14ec644dd21d65a754488ec01a0f990c89827aafa6b92c213
spent
true